First, the general category-expression skills, (art) expression, expression, rhetoric and writing.

This group of terms (concepts) is a very disturbing and confusing term, which is often used by proponents in the trunk of the problem. If students don't grasp the connotation and extension, and don't know their specific direction, they will lose points because they fail the exam. Generally speaking, these terms are not juxtaposed, and there is a relationship between inclusion and inclusion. The expressions of "expression skills" and "writing skills" are relatively general, mainly based on the overall writing skills of poetry, so the answer angle can be large or small, either focusing on overall analysis or local analysis, as long as it makes sense. The expressions of "expression", "expression" and "rhetoric" are a concrete analysis of the whole or part of the poem, which is mostly manifested in the analysis and understanding of the part in the examination.
